The World Championship returns to the Bronx for the first time since 1962.  George Steinbrenner lures Reggie Jackson to the Yankees and he joins Graig Nettles, Thurmon Munson and a strong pitching rotation to build on the 1976 World Series appearance where they were swept by the Big Red Machine.  It wasn't an easy journey for the Yankees, however.  The American League East was very strong as both the Baltimore Orioles and the Boston Red Sox battled the Yankees all the way to the end with both teams finishing just 2.5 games behind the Bronx Bombers.  In the American League West, the Kansas City Royals continued their winning ways, with 102 victories.  The Philadelphia Phillies won the NL East and the Los Angeles Dodgers, thanks in part two four players hitting at least 30 Home Runs, took home the NL West flag.  Baseball fans were captivated in 1977 as Rod Carew flirted with .400 the entire season and was named the AL MVP.  George Foster walloped an NL Record 52 Home Runs and took home the NL MVP award while the Lefty, Steve Carlton, won 23 games and took home the NL Cy Young Award    Sparkly Lyle, the outstanding Yankee reliever, won the AL Cy Young Award.  The Yankees beat the Royals in a tough AL Championship Series while the Dodgers emerged over the Phillies.  Reggie Jackson becomes Mr. October as he leads the Yankees over the Dodgers in the World Series capping it off with the amazing 3 Home Runs on 3 Pitches in Game 6 of the series.  The 1977 baseball season is forever etched in the history and lore of Major League Baseball.  Relive it all with Dugout Steps Baseball and the 1977 Season Set.
